Swiss Stablecoin Sandbox Enters Testing Phase With Two New Partners

3h ago · 1 source · Summarised by CryptoBipto — how we make this

Switzerland's stablecoin regulatory sandbox has moved into its testing phase and added two new partners to the initiative. The sandbox is designed to allow companies to experiment with stablecoin-related services within a controlled regulatory environment. The development signals continued Swiss engagement with digital asset innovation through structured regulatory frameworks.

WHY IT MATTERS

A regulatory sandbox is like a practice field for new financial products. Instead of requiring companies to meet every rule before they can try something new, regulators create a safe space where companies can test their ideas under supervision. Think of it like a learner's permit for driving — you can practice, but with guardrails in place. In this case, Switzerland is letting companies experiment with stablecoins, which are cryptocurrencies designed to hold a steady value (usually matching a traditional currency like the US dollar or Swiss franc). This matters because how governments choose to regulate stablecoins will shape whether and how people can use them in everyday life. Switzerland's approach of testing before setting final rules could serve as a model for other countries figuring out their own crypto regulations.
